How many Bay City Rollers are there?
How many Bay City Rollers are there?
Now only three of the ‘classic five’ Rollers line-up remain: founding member and drummer Derek Longmuir, 69, guitarist Stuart ‘Woody’ Wood, 64, and songwriter and guitarist Eric Faulkner, 67. The fifth, ‘original Roller’ Alan Longmuir, died in 2018 after contracting a mystery virus on holiday in Mexico.
Which Bay City Rollers are dead?
Les McKeown
Les McKeown, best known as the singer for Scotland’s Bay City Rollers, died April 20 of unspecified causes. He was 65. “It is with profound sadness that we announce the death of our beloved husband and father Leslie Richard McKeown,” wrote wife Peko Keiko and son Jubei McKeown on the singer’s Facebook account.
What year did the Bay City Rollers have their first hit?
1975
They scored their first U.S. hit with “Saturday Night,” which was released in September 1975 and hit number one in January 1976.

Which Bay City Roller went to jail?
Longmuir
He appeared on each of the band’s nine studio albums through to 1981. He retired from the music industry in the early 1980s and trained as a nurse working at Edinburgh Royal Infirmary. In 2000, Longmuir was sentenced to 300 hours’ community service after admitting possessing child pornography.
Did Bay City Rollers get their royalties?
However, since Arista had continued to promise the Bay City Rollers their royalties in writing, the judge ruled that the statute was not applicable. Arista Records’ parent company, Sony Music, is believed to have paid $3.5 million, with each band member receiving £70,000.
What are the Bay City Rollers worth?
Summary: In the 1970s The Bay City Rollers, five teenagers from Scotland, became the biggest band in the world. They sold over 120 million records, and topped the charts in every record-selling country in the world, generating an industry worth over £5 billion in today’s money.
